Virtual Interactive Meeting on India-Vietnam Trade in Agriculture and Allied Commodities

Posted on: September 14, 2021 | Back | Print

In the series of events to mark the 75th anniversary year of India’s Independence and as part of efforts to promote agricultural cooperation and trade between India and Vietnam, the Embassy of India in Vietnam organized a virtual interactive meeting on trade in agro and allied commodities on 13th September 2021 to facilitate interaction between the regulatory authorities of the two countries and enable exchange of views on the entire spectrum of regulatory and market access issues in order to promote bilateral agriculture trade.

In him opening remarks, Ambassador of India, Pranay Verma highlighted the salience of agriculture and allied commodities in India-Vietnam bilateral trade by accounting for nearly 20% of the bilateral trade basket in 2020-21. He noted that agriculture trade brings direct benefits to farming communities of the two countries and is therefore, an important priority in Embassy's trade promotion activities. Ambassador said that agricultural cooperation has also been one of the mainstays of traditional bilateral cooperation between India and Vietnam as symbolized by iconic Indian development projects in Vietnam such as the Cuu Long Delta Rice Research Institute and Southern Fruit Research Institute (SOFRI) in Tien Giang set up in 1970s and 80s.

Ambassador hoped that the initiative taken by the Embassy through this interactive webinar would offer a platform to the two sides to exchange views and clarify regulatory practices to enhance trade in agriculture and allied commodities through better understanding of each other’s sanitary and phyto-sanitary standards, control and quality measures as well as market access issues between the two countries.

The webinar was attended by representatives of the regulatory bodies and relevant organizations on both sides with responsibility for ensuring quality and safety standards in trade of plant and animal-based products. From India, the Directorate of Plant Protection, Quarantine and Storage (DPQS), Exports Inspection Council of India (EIC), the Agricultural and Processed Food Products Export Development Authority (APEDA), Trade Division under the Department of Agriculture & Farmers Welfare attended the event. From Vietnam, Department of Plant Protection, Department of Animal Health and Vietnam Chamber of Commerce and Industry participated. The meeting was followed by an online interactive session between these regulatory bodies and agricultural companies from both sides.

The regulatory bodies and relevant departments between India and Vietnam shared information on, inter-alia, import regulations of plant as well as animal-based products, quality and food safety control measures, rules on contaminants as well as pesticide management, technical requirements for market access, compliance on quarantine rules, digitization of application process for issuance of phytosanitary certificates, surveillance and inspection measures. While explaining roles and functions of their respective organizations, the regulatory bodies also responded to specific queries from agro-companies from both sides, particularly on the process for market access for specific agricultural and allied commodities.
